TRAINS COLLIDE.
One Engineer Killed and Two Others Hurt by a Railway DlonsterNeor Fond do Lac, Wlo. Milwaukee, April 27.—A special t« the Evening Wisconsin from Fond du Lac, Wis., says: A special double hender freight train and the Green Bay passenger train collided on a bridge half a mile north of here Tuesday. Engineer Dolan, of the first freight engine, was killed, and Engineer Nelson, of th* second engine, was badly hurt. Passenger Engineer Ackerman was badly bruised. Firemen escaped by jumping in the river. No passengers were injured.
